12 July 2013 A company engaged in the business of constructing and selling the commercial premises. In one of the building, the company has some unsold units. Such units are given on long term lease ( 5 yrs). However, the said units would be ultimately sold in future. The company is paying the common area maintenance charges to the Society.

Whether such lease rental should be treated as income from house property or business income?

12 July 2013 Since it is business of assessee it becomes stock in trade and you recv rent by renting stock in trade in my opinion its income from business only.
